Output 6528d5d0b46f36020bffb858ed6490a04ee4b9607f6e77488385ecd2ffc3c771:0

value
18852214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c728973a7dbaacea51cf1b88f3fb59432b75a98 OP_EQUAL
address
3D32vVhAPbdNWVmwEcsztpdkQgVnxhSScS
transaction
6528d5d0b46f36020bffb858ed6490a04ee4b9607f6e77488385ecd2ffc3c771
spent
true